fix(stores): align RPC methods with OpenClaw protocol and fix chat flow
- Fix channels store: use channels.status instead of channels.list - Fix skills store: use skills.status instead of skills.list - Fix chat store: correct chat.history response parsing (messages in payload) - Fix chat store: handle chat.send async flow (ack + event streaming) - Add chat event handling for streaming AI responses (delta/final/error) - Wire gateway:chat-message IPC events to chat store - Fix health check: use WebSocket status instead of nonexistent /health endpoint - Fix waitForReady: probe via WebSocket instead of HTTP - Gracefully degrade when methods are unsupported (no white screen)
